Detailed Comparison

MetricBuilding Finishing TradesCleaning and Housekeeping Managers and SupervisorsDifference
Median Annual£33,369£26,492+£6,877
Mean Annual£34,220£26,127+£8,093
Monthly£2,781£2,208+£573
Weekly£642£509+£133
Hourly£16.04£12.74+£3.30
